- Radio Spots: Radio advertising is available in 30 or 60 second spots. Larger agencies can buy spots on the big stations, but don't underestimate the power of small college radio stations – they are not just for college students.
- Digital Advertising: See how you can get noticed online with local publications. Digital ads consist of carousel ads, video ads, click-to-watch video ads (https://agents.smartfinancial.com/resource/video-advertising-for-insurance-agents), mobile app install ads, native social ads and much more. If there's somewhere on the internet you want to be seen, click around to see if you can get rates to advertise. You can also work with a native advertising agency that can narrow down your demographic with their clients.
- Advertorials: Many magazines and newspapers sell advertorials, which are paid editorials, in which you can introduce yourself to your community. It's often hard to tell an advertorial from a traditional magazine or newspaper feature, and it's a great way to get people . Some are more obvious than others, of course. You can try it out and see if you get any insurance leads from the effort.
- Gas Stations: You can place an ad on top of a gas pump or air an audio ad that will get many people's attention while they pump gas. You will have the right target audience if you're selling car insurance and probably home or renters insurance too.
- Gyms, Yoga Studios and Day Spas: Advertising in TV spots at gyms is a great way to get insurance leads. Even simply leaving your business card at gyms, yoga studios and day spas may result in calls!
